While Rogerstone station may not boast an abundance of services, it ensures accessibility and convenience for all travelers. Despite the absence of a traditional ticket office, the station is equipped with ticket machines, essential for both ticket purchase and collection. For convenience, smartcard validators are available, though the station does not issue smartcards. In terms of accessibility, this station receives high marks—classified as Category A, it presents step-free access throughout. Although there is no waiting room or staff on hand at all times, travelers can make use of the seating areas available on site.
Should you require assistance, Rogerstone station is equipped with help points and an induction loop to support those with hearing impairments. There is also a helpline available for booking assistance up to two hours before your journey, enhancing travel ease. Despite the lack of amenities like shops or refreshment facilities, the station ensures safety with CCTV and has a well-equipped car park open 24 hours with no parking fees. For cyclists, there are secure bicycle stands and lockers, although cycle hire options aren't currently available.

The station ensures a seamless experience with a comprehensive array of facilities. Whether buying a ticket or picking up one pre-purchased online, passengers can utilize the ticket machines which are accessible for all, including those with disabilities. The station also offers smartcards for a modern touch to your travel needs. For any assistance, staff help is widely available through help points, information screens, and the dedicated Customer Service Centre, ensuring that a helpful hand is never far away. Additionally, there's step-free access throughout the station, including long ramps for ease of movement.
Bournemouth Train Station might lack a traditional waiting room, but there's ample seating available for travelers awaiting departure. While it does not offer lounge services, refreshments can be found on Platforms 2 and 3, including a Starbucks. Best not to rely on finding ATMs or shops here, however. For those needing to stay connected, complimentary public Wi-Fi is available, with helpful links to hotspots around the station.
Travelers will benefit from the station's excellent transport connectivity. For those moving onward by car, there are 362 parking spaces available and specially marked bays for Blue Badge holders. If you arrive by bike, there are 118 spaces with sheltered cycle storage under CCTV. For public transportation users, buses and taxis provide seamless travel to further destinations. The airport is easily accessible via Morebus service 737, while the station is a pivotal access point for rail replacement services reaching Southampton and Poole.
